Wing Commander Saga Plus

As direct support of the original WC Saga mod appears to have come to an end, Luke has picked up the ball and is making good progress with his enhancement pack dubbed WC Saga Plus. In addition to support for multiple languages, improvements are being made to the ship viewer, fiction viewer, heads up display, mission editor and mission briefings. There is also helpful popup text and a menu interface for enabling various upgrades. The pictures below largely show German text, but English will also be available when the package is released. Plus remains in closed testing at the moment, but Luke will continue to share status on the project until it's ready. You can find more details here.










What exactly is Wing Commander Saga Plus?

The first (and at the beginning the only) priority of WCS+ was to create a platform (engine) for our WCS German-Mod Project. For this I learned the basics of C++ after the WCS source code was published in November 2013. Then after I made all texts translatable, I became bolder and tried also to realize some of the ideas the pilots from WingCenter had after the WCS release. And this was also successful. A dream becomes reality: give WCS some changes and improvements. WCS+ is a slightly improved engine with some new features for players and modders and also a few bug fixes.

That's complex.
If I recall correctly there were some features that weren't compatible, and Tolwyn decided not to wait for a new SCP release because there were some blockers preventing it from released, then another feature was released by the SCP that would have required re-coding a lot of missions and scripts.
And then WCS needed some features that were rejected by the SCP because they break other features WCS didn't use, and so on.

So WCS was forked.

But let me say this very clearly: the original WCS team is no longer existing. Sometimes you see here and there a member of this team, like Tolwyn, Keldor or Aginor, but that was it. The most members are gone and they deserved their retirement very well i mean. Arrow and me founded a completely new team for the translation project in 2013. Arrow made the first work on the translation 2009, and i begun 2012 as completely new WCS player with absolutely no game modding or game development experience. And another point: WCS Deutsch-Mod and WCS+ have nothing to do with WCS Open and our team have nothing to do with HLP or SCP. Our primary goal is to translate WCS into german language with high quality, not more, not less. I started also with the WCS+ project because we missed several features in the engine for our translation project. The "WCS Plus Pack" will be a byproduct from our translation project i plan to publish if we finished our Mod project. With WCS+ we have all what we need to finish our work and i was also able to realize some of the ideas a few WCS pilots had after the WCS release in 2012.
